Skip to content

Commit 5d203bc

Browse files
committed
General cleanup
1 parent 6d19eae commit 5d203bc

File tree

4 files changed

+8
-53
lines changed

4 files changed

+8
-53
lines changed

spring-cloud-function-adapters/spring-cloud-function-grpc/src/test/java/org/springframework/cloud/function/grpc/GrpcInteractionTests.java

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-33,7 +33,6 @@
3333
import org.springframework.boot.WebApplicationType;
3434
import org.springframework.boot.autoconfigure.EnableAutoConfiguration;
3535
import org.springframework.boot.builder.SpringApplicationBuilder;
36-
import org.springframework.cloud.function.utils.SocketUtils;
3736
import org.springframework.context.ConfigurableApplicationContext;
3837
import org.springframework.context.annotation.Bean;
3938
import org.springframework.messaging.Message;

spring-cloud-function-context/src/main/java/org/springframework/cloud/function/context/config/JsonMessageConverter.java

Lines changed: 8 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-31,6 +31,7 @@
3131
import org.springframework.messaging.converter.AbstractMessageConverter;
3232
import org.springframework.messaging.converter.MessageConverter;
3333
import org.springframework.util.MimeType;
34+
import org.springframework.util.MimeTypeUtils;
3435
import org.springframework.util.StringUtils;
3536

3637
/**
@@ -47,7 +48,9 @@ public class JsonMessageConverter extends AbstractMessageConverter {
4748
private final JsonMapper jsonMapper;
4849

4950
public JsonMessageConverter(JsonMapper jsonMapper) {
50-
this(jsonMapper, new MimeType("application", "json"), new MimeType(CloudEventMessageUtils.APPLICATION_CLOUDEVENTS.getType(),
51+
52+
this(jsonMapper, new MimeType(MimeTypeUtils.APPLICATION_JSON, StandardCharsets.UTF_8),
53+
new MimeType(CloudEventMessageUtils.APPLICATION_CLOUDEVENTS.getType(),
5154
CloudEventMessageUtils.APPLICATION_CLOUDEVENTS.getSubtype() + "+json"));
5255
}
5356

@@ -101,8 +104,8 @@ protected Object convertFromInternal(Message<?> message, Class<?> targetClass, @
101104
return message.getPayload();
102105
}
103106
}
104-
if (targetClass == byte[].class && message.getPayload() instanceof String) {
105-
return ((String) message.getPayload()).getBytes(StandardCharsets.UTF_8);
107+
if (targetClass == byte[].class && message.getPayload() instanceof String stringPayload) {
108+
return stringPayload.getBytes(StandardCharsets.UTF_8);
106109
}
107110
else {
108111
try {
@@ -114,8 +117,8 @@ protected Object convertFromInternal(Message<?> message, Class<?> targetClass, @
114117
}
115118
else if (logger.isDebugEnabled()) {
116119
Object payload = message.getPayload();
117-
if (payload instanceof byte[]) {
118-
payload = new String((byte[]) payload, StandardCharsets.UTF_8);
120+
if (payload instanceof byte[] bytePayload) {
121+
payload = new String(bytePayload, StandardCharsets.UTF_8);
119122
}
120123
logger.debug("Failed to convert value: " + payload + " to: " + targetClass, e);
121124
}

spring-cloud-function-context/src/main/java/org/springframework/cloud/function/utils/FunctionMessageUtils.java

Lines changed: 0 additions & 9 deletions
Original file line numberDiff line numberDiff line change
@@ -20,7 +20,6 @@
2020
import java.util.Locale;
2121

2222
import org.springframework.cloud.function.context.message.MessageUtils;
23-
import org.springframework.messaging.Message;
2423
import org.springframework.messaging.MessageHeaders;
2524

2625
/**
@@ -36,14 +35,6 @@ private FunctionMessageUtils() {
3635

3736
}
3837

39-
public static String getSourceType(String functionDefinition, Message<?> message) {
40-
return determineSourceFromHeaders(message.getHeaders());
41-
}
42-
43-
public static String getTargetType(String functionDefinition, Message<?> message) {
44-
return message.getHeaders().containsKey(MessageUtils.TARGET_PROTOCOL) ? (String) message.getHeaders().get(MessageUtils.TARGET_PROTOCOL) : "unknown";
45-
}
46-
4738
private static String determineSourceFromHeaders(MessageHeaders headers) {
4839
for (String key : headers.keySet()) {
4940
if (key.equals(MessageUtils.SOURCE_TYPE)) {

spring-cloud-function-context/src/main/java/org/springframework/cloud/function/utils/SocketUtils.java

Lines changed: 0 additions & 38 deletions
This file was deleted.

0 commit comments

Comments
 (0)